Dreamland
Dreamland is a term used in English to denote an idealized, dream-like place or state, often associated with escape, fantasy, or happiness. In literature and folklore it can refer to a utopian realm that embodies wishful thinking or a respite from ordinary life. As a proper noun, it is also used for various places, venues, and works of art.
